Tips for Optimizing Performance of Your C# Website
1. Use Asynchronous Programming: Asynchronous programming allows your website to perform multiple tasks at the same time, which can significantly improve performance.
2. Use Caching: Caching can help reduce the amount of data that needs to be retrieved from the database, resulting in faster page loading times.
3. Use Compression: Compressing your website’s data can reduce the amount of data that needs to be transferred, resulting in faster page loading times.
4. Use a Content Delivery Network (CDN): A CDN can help reduce the amount of time it takes for your website’s content to be delivered to the user’s browser.
5. Optimize Your Database Queries: Optimizing your database queries can help reduce the amount of time it takes for the database to process the query and return the results.
6. Use a Profiler: A profiler can help you identify areas of your code that are causing performance issues.
7. Use a Performance Testing Tool: Performance testing tools can help you identify areas of your website that are causing performance issues.
8. Use a Performance Monitoring Tool: Performance monitoring tools can help you identify areas of your website that are causing performance issues and help you track performance over time.
9. Use a Load Balancer: A load balancer can help distribute the load across multiple servers, resulting in improved performance.
10. Use a Web Server Optimization Tool: Web server optimization tools can help you optimize your web server configuration for improved performance.

Best Practices for Securing Your C# Website
1. Use Secure Connections: Make sure your website is using secure connections such as HTTPS and TLS. This will ensure that all data sent between the server and the client is encrypted and secure.
2. Use Strong Passwords: Make sure all user accounts have strong passwords that are difficult to guess. This will help protect your website from brute force attacks.
3. Use Authentication: Implement authentication for all users. This will ensure that only authorized users can access the website.
4. Use Authorization: Implement authorization for all users. This will ensure that users can only access the resources they are allowed to access.
5. Use Input Validation: Validate all user input to ensure that it is valid and not malicious. This will help protect your website from malicious attacks.
6. Use Encryption: Encrypt all sensitive data such as passwords and credit card numbers. This will help protect your website from data theft.
7. Use Logging: Implement logging for all user actions. This will help you track any suspicious activity on your website.
8. Use Security Patches: Make sure to keep your website up to date with the latest security patches. This will help protect your website from any newly discovered vulnerabilities.
9. Use Security Scans: Regularly scan your website for any security vulnerabilities. This will help you identify any potential security issues before they become a problem.
10. Use Security Audits: Perform regular security audits of your website. This will help you identify any potential security issues and take steps to fix them.
